Troy Long

September 23, 1926 — August 27, 2017

Troy Long, 90, of Highland Village, entered the presence of the Lord on Sunday, August 27, 2017 in Highland Village. He was born on September 23, 1926 in Gainesville, son of James Henry Long and Lela Bullard Long.

Troy was a member of the Baptist faith, a 32nd degree Mason, and Shriner. He was a veteran of WWII, serving in the U.S. Navy. Troy was a printer and retired from Plymouth Park Baptist Church in Irving.

Mr. Long was preceded in death by his parents and brother Jack Haden Long.

Left to love and cherish his memory are his wife of 67 years Helen Elizabeth (Betty) Nichols; children and spouses: Roslyn & Gary McGowan of Lewisville, Rhonda & David Collier of Sulphur Springs, and Terry & Lisa Long of Highland Village; several grandchildren, great-grandchildren and a great-great grandson.

A Masonic graveside service with military honors is scheduled for 10:00 AM on Thursday, August 31, 2017 at Fairview Cemetery, Gainesville, with Pastor Cliff Feeler officiating.

In lieu of flowers, memorials can be donated to the Texas Scottish Rite Hospital for Children.
